Clearing Check Engine Light on 2005 Chevy Silverado
If your 2005 Chevy Silverado’s check engine light is illuminated, it can be concerning. Fortunately, there are straightforward methods to clear the light and address any underlying issues. This section outlines the steps you can take to reset the check engine light effectively.
Follow these steps to clear the check engine light effectively.
-
Connect the OBD-II scanner to the vehicle’s diagnostic port, usually located under the dashboard.
-
Turn on the ignition without starting the engine to power the scanner.
-
Select the option to read trouble codes on the scanner display.
-
Document any codes that appear for future reference.
-
Choose the option to clear the codes and reset the check engine light.
-
Disconnect the scanner and start the engine to verify that the light is off.
2005 Chevy Silverado Common Trouble Codes
Understanding the common trouble codes for a 2005 Chevy Silverado is essential for diagnosing issues and clearing the check engine light. These codes provide valuable insights into the vehicle’s performance and help pinpoint specific problems that may arise. Familiarizing yourself with these codes can streamline the troubleshooting process and ensure your truck runs smoothly.
Understanding common trouble codes can help you identify issues more effectively. Here are a few frequent codes associated with the 2005 Chevy Silverado.
| Code | Description | Possible Cause |
|---|---|---|
| P0300 | Random/multiple cylinder misfire | Faulty spark plugs or coils |
| P0420 | Catalyst system efficiency | Faulty catalytic converter |
| P0442 | Evaporative emission system | Leaking fuel cap or hoses |
Persistent Check Engine Light Issues in 2005 Chevy Silverado
Many owners of the 2005 Chevy Silverado experience persistent check engine light issues, which can stem from various underlying problems. Understanding the common causes and troubleshooting steps is essential for effectively addressing these concerns and ensuring your vehicle runs smoothly. This section delves into the frequent triggers behind the check engine light and offers guidance on how to resolve them.
If the check engine light returns after clearing, further investigation is necessary. Persistent codes may indicate underlying issues that require repairs.
-
Inspect wiring: Check for damaged or corroded wires connected to sensors.
-
Examine sensors: Look for faulty oxygen sensors or mass airflow sensors.
-
Check for leaks: Inspect the fuel and vacuum systems for any leaks.
